One of the key strengths of biotech pharmaceutical companies is their ability to harness the power of biotechnology to target specific diseases and conditions at the molecular level. Unlike traditional pharmaceutical companies that rely on chemical compounds, biotech companies use living organisms or biological systems to develop their products. This opens up a whole new world of possibilities for drug development and allows for more precise and targeted treatments.
biotech pharmaceutical companies also play a vital role in advancing personalized medicine, which aims to tailor medical treatments to the individual characteristics of each patient. By analyzing a patient’s genetic makeup, lifestyle, and environmental factors, biotech companies can develop therapies that are customized to their unique needs. This can lead to more effective treatments with fewer side effects, ultimately improving patient outcomes and quality of life.

Despite their many strengths, biotech pharmaceutical companies face a number of challenges in the highly competitive healthcare industry. The cost of drug development is a major hurdle for many biotech companies, as bringing a new treatment to market can require significant financial investment and time. In addition, regulatory hurdles, market access issues, and intellectual property concerns can also pose obstacles to the success of biotech companies.
